We are supposed to build a battery house with a 120V DC 60 units 2V 1000AH battery, However since we have a constraint regarding space, Is it possible that we make a Nema 3R Enclosure for this with a adequate ventilation. We are planning to use a maintenance free sealed type battery, Do we violate any code?

Heed NEC Article 480. 3R implies outdoor installation. Offhand, battery performance will be awful if temperature variations are an issue—especially for hot climates. 1000AH cells are expensive components for disregarding room/enclosure temperature control.

Dilute sulfuric acid is murder on 304 alloy. 316 alloy is somewhat better.
 
Busbar, thanks for the info. Do you mean that even a sealed type maintenace free battery has a sulfuric acid emission... Will a galvanized enclosure will do? Instead of 316 Aloy
 

There are others here better qualified to advise. I have had "less than antiseptic" VRLA performance, but I'm not a battery guy. What’s the set powering?
 
Busbar, Yes this battery is for our swicthyard 115/13.8kV. Presently, we have a battery panel for each substation. However, we are now unitizing the control system and polanning to centralized DC Power supply.
